Disk usage limit for Time Machine not showing on Ventura

I'm setting up Time Machine for the first time on Ventura (13.5.2). When I add a disk, I get the options to encrypt and to add a password but I don't get the option to limit the disk usage. This is important for me as the backup is to a NAS and I don't want to fill it with Time Machine backups.


Any ideas? Is this feature limited to certain types of backup destinations?
